Amado González is a human[1]. His place of birth was Bilbao[2]. He was born on January 1, 1889[3]. He died in Burgos[4]. He died on January 1, 1945[5]. He worked as a Catholic priest[6]. He is known by 5 alternative names across languages and contexts.[7]
